Abstract

Pot Grate tests were carried out in the pilot plant at Samarco producing pellets containing SiO2 between 2.0% and 2.2% in a wide range of basicity to be used in blast furnace. These pellets were submitted to tests in Samarco's laboratory and another laboratory in Germany to evaluate the metallurgical properties. The pellets in the binary basicity range (CaO/SiO2) from 0,87 to 0,95 were those that presented the best results in the Pot Grate tests. Based on the results, these pellets are being routinely produced?on industrial-scale confirming the results observed in laboratory tests.?
